Landslip Remediation for Oyster Lease Road

Brunswick Heads

NSW National Parks and Wildlife Services

Infrastructure

Following major flooding in 2022, a landslip was identified along the northern riverbank of the Brunswick River, immediately adjacent to Oyster Lease Road. LRC Geotechnical was engaged to undertake a geotechnical investigation, landslide risk assessment, and reporting to inform the design of potential remediation measures. The investigation identified a shallow translational failure within the riverbank, with opportunities for remediation through a “soft engineering” approach incorporating anchored vegetative reinforcement matting. The scope of geotechnical services included: Coordination and management of traffic control operation to facilitate local road closure to allow for safe drilling operations. Geotechnical investigation with boreholes to 15 m to ascertain subsurface conditions and groundwaters. Detailed laboratory testing programme to determine the engineering properties of the underlying soils and rock materials. Slope stability assessment to evaluate potential for regressive landslip causing undermining or complete damage to Oyster Lease Road. Engineering discussion and presentation of possible landslip remediation options.
